Reduce, Reuse, Recycle

November 15th is America Recycles Day. Bend Garbage & Recycling offers commingle and glass recycling in the city and county, yard debris and commercial food waste recycling within the Bend city limits.

Here are some recycling tips to get you started:
  • Purchase items made from recycled materials and local products when possible.
  • Reduce paper and ink by printing in black and white and on both sides of the paper.
  • Donate household items instead of throwing them away.
  • Use reusable totes at the grocery store. Bring plastic grocery bags back to the store for reuse.
  • If possible, do not buy items that use Styrofoam in the packaging. Styrofoam does not decompose.
  • Clamshells are plastic containers used for packaging berries, lettuce and bakery items are not accepted in our local recycling program. They need to go as trash or be reused.

Can Garden Hoses go in your Commingle Recycling Carts?

No, Garden hoses are not accepted in your commingle recycling or yard debris carts. To achieve a successful program, it is important to only include materials that are accepted in your local recycling program. Garden hoses are a contaminant and should go in the trash cart, or if it can be reused, donate it to a thrift store.

Yard debris program accepts grass clippings, brush, weeds, plant prunings, pine needles, branches no larger than 2" in diameter and 36" in length and raw fruit and vegetable scraps.

Normal Collection Schedule on Thanksgiving

Bend Garbage & Recycling will be operating on a normal collection schedule on Thanksgiving, Thursday, November 27, 2014.

Customers who have garbage & recycling collection service on Thursday's should have their carts out by 6:00 a.m. on Thanksgiving Day.

The Bend Garbage & Recycling office will be closed on Thursday, November 27 and will reopen Friday, November 28 at 8:00 a.m.

Bend Garbage & Recycling collects on all holidays except for Christmas Day and New Year's Day. The year our Thursday and Friday customers will be affected by our holiday collection schedule.

Beginning Thursday, December 25th and Thursday January 1st, regular garbage and recycling service will be one day late for both holiday weeks.

Regular scheduled collections days of Thursday and Friday will be serviced Friday and Saturday.

For example, if your regular collection day is Thursday, your service day will be Friday. If you collection day is Friday, your service day will be Saturday.

This schedule will be in effect December 25, 2014 - January 4, 2015.

Half Price Yard Debris Recycling


Monday, October 27 - Saturday, November 8, 2014 (closed Sunday, November 2), residents can recycle their yard debris at Deschutes Recycling for half price - only $2.00 per cubic yard.  The yard debris will be recycled into compost and clean energy fuel.

FireFree encourages residents to complete their fall clean up and maintenance of defensible space by bringing branches, leaves, shrubs and pine needles to Deschutes Recycling during this event.

Stumps must be smaller than 12" in diameter or they will not be accepted.

While at Deschutes Recycling, take advantage of the 25% off compost sale going on through November 29, 2014.  Compost is an essential ingredient to winterizing your lawn and garden.
